Transaction 22bd31f6444691774647f032f8bc9e254a5dc81f485faf295213adaeb4985974
2 Input
2 Outputs
- 22bd31f6444691774647f032f8bc9e254a5dc81f485faf295213adaeb4985974:0
- 22bd31f6444691774647f032f8bc9e254a5dc81f485faf295213adaeb4985974:1
value 20000
address 12geErfbqq7yBks42EcPsUsj6WKSmoyDZU
value 15252
address 18aM1ocHNanJMyrfDdtJSrt3kmZWtSFWoM